Continuing to send a blocked newsletter
This guide explains why a newsletter might be blocked from being sent and how to continue sending a blocked newsletter.
Why block a newsletter from being sent?
As a Mail hosting provider and newsletter service provider, Infomaniak can and must take all steps necessary to prevent any spamming abuse.
Please be aware of the following steps:
- A newsletter is blocked from being sent if too many of the recipient email addresses are invalid
- A newsletter may be blocked if the SPAM rate is too high
- After a newsletter has been blocked, you must contact our support team to be able to send the blocked message
In order to avoid this situation:
- use only contact lists you have made up yourself
- make up your contact lists with double opt-in forms (to find out more)
- remove contacts you have not written to for over 6 months. Seldom-used contact lists also risk containing obsolete email addresses
- if needed, automatically clean your subscriber list with services such as neverbounce, bounceless or quickemailverification
Completing the sending of a blocked newsletter
After you have contacted our support team to unblock the sending:
- open the newsletter tool (https://newsletter.infomaniak.com)
- go to Newsletters
- click on the newsletter which has been blocked from being sent
- go to the last step Validation & Sending
- click on Send the newsletter. The newsletter will automatically be sent to the contacts which have not yet received it
